The Royal Barbados Police Force is seeking the assistance of the public in locating Mikelah Vaughan Griffith, 14, of Downes Gap, Arthur Seat, St Thomas.

Police said Griffith is 5 feet 2 inches tall, has a dark complexion and is slimly built. She walks with an erect appearance and is full breasted.

She has a long neck, round face, full eyes, arched teeth, broad lips, broad nose and large ears. Each ear is pierced once. Griffith speaks with a heavy voice.

Her clothing and hairstyle are unknown at this time.

Police said Griffith left home on December 23, around 6:55 a.m. to meet her paternal grandmother. After completing shopping around 9 a.m., “she placed her in a PSV with the expectation that she would return home”. Griffith did not return home and was reported missing by her father Michael Griffith.

Anyone with information in relation to Griffith is asked to contact District ‘D’ Police Station at 419-1726, Police Emergency 211, Crime Stoppers at 1-800-TIPS (8477), or the nearest police station. (PR)
